If you’re anything like me, there have probably been times when you’ve listened to someone telling you about a calling, or a vision to do something wonderful and, far from finding it inspiring, you’ve felt intimidated.

Or perhaps you’ve read about how such and such an organisation or charity began. The way in which first one person felt led to do a particular work, then another and another, followed by all sorts of seemingly impossible God-incidences, occurrences which have miraculously come together – and you’ve thought to yourself: Well that’s all very well, but I’m a pretty unimportant, insignificant sort of person. What does this have to say to me?

Being a grandma has led me to think about that. My youngest daughter had twins. When they were four and, because I cared for them twice a week while their Mummy taught at a primary school, I was a fairly big part of their lives. But there were times, when you might have thought Grandma was pretty unimportant in their reckoning.

Anyone who tells you that boys and girls are alike is talking rubbish! It may have been a Sumerian in Mesopotamia who designed the first known wheel in 3,500 BC, but without a doubt it was a Mr Sumerian, not a Mrs. The fascination with circular moving apparatus has been hard-wired into the male psyche ever since.

So Sammy, if not an inventor of the wheel, was certainly obsessed with them. Consequently, I was more than likely to find him on his tummy, bottom in the air, head sideways on the floor, watching the effect of pushing a small wheeled toy across the carpet. He was completely oblivious to anything or anyone else around him – me and his Mummy included.

Girls, of course, oil the wheels of social intercourse. Everyone knows that’s how Eve got into trouble in the first place, chatting with the Enemy in the Garden of Eden. Being the wily old serpent that he is, he was well aware that an encounter with Adam would have been totally unproductive. All he’d have got out of him would have been a grunt!

Naturally, being a girl, my granddaughter Pippa wanted to relate; to communicate. Usually that happened when I was well into my Sudoku and she wanted to help. “Eight here,” she would say, authoritatively (as only a four-year old can) and she would jab her finger all over the page. Invading your space, elbows in your ribs, head walloping on your bosom, and nearly knocking your teeth out, she was completely unaware of your discomfort. Even though she was the cause of it!

To anyone who didn’t know any better, it must have looked as if Grandma’s presence and comfort were of no great concern to the twins. But when Mummy came to collect the two of them, after work, Sammy would cry because he didn’t want to leave! And Pippa would be all over you saying “Love you Grandma.”

You see, appearances may be deceptive. So if you feel inadequate or inconsequential, just think again! As did Jabez, a Biblical character.

Jabez – meaning 'he causes pain' - was so named, by his mother, because of his difficult birth. He thus had a troubled beginning of life. His potted history looks pretty unimportant among all the genealogies in Chronicles.

  • His origins were like a tiny insignificant seed.

  • We know nothing of his life. It was hidden, as if in the soil.

  • His prayer, asking for God's blessing upon him, His guidance, and His protection from evil appears to have been little more than a humble bloom

Is this how you feel? INSIGNIFICANT? HIDDEN? HUMBLE? Well, it’s just not true!

  • Jabez's origins may have appeared to be INSIGNIFICANT but in God’s sight, he became PROMINENTand so can you! See what the psalmist says:

  • For you created my inmost being; you knit me together in my mother’s womb. . . My frame was not hidden from you when I was made in the secret place. When I was woven together in the depths of the earth, your eyes saw my unformed body. All the days ordained for me were written in your book before one of them came to be.” Psalm 139:13, 15, and 16

  • Jabez's biography was HIDDEN among the genealogies. But he, himself, was NAMEDand so are you! Through the prophet, Isaiah, God says:

  • See, I have engraved you on the palms of my hands.” Isaiah 49:16

It was a HUMBLE prayer that Jabez prayed, asking God to enlarge his vision, to give him His guidance, and to protect him from evil. But it has INSPIRED people for generations! And so can you. The Gospels tell us: You (that’s you and me) are the light of the world. . . Therefore I tell you, whatever you ask for in prayer, believe that you have received it, and it will be yours. Mark 11:24. Let your light shine before men, that they may see your good deeds and praise your Father in heaven. Matthew 5:14 and 16

So don't allow yourself to be disempowered by wrongful thinking. You – me – we are all important in this world if we put our trust in God, and follow in His footsteps.
